Padraig Murphy and Dominic McDowall in conversation with Jordan Sorcery.
Dominic McDowall, CEO of Cubicle 7, and Padraig Murphy, producer of the WFRP 4 edition range, join me to about the development of the 4th edition of Warhammer Fantasy Roleplay.
We talk about designing new supplements, updating old ones, the future of the range, and just a little bit about the recently announced The Old World RPG that is currently in development.

Steve Jackson | Games Workshop & Fighting Fantasy Founder
Steve Jackson in conversation with Jordan Sorcery
We talk about founding Games Workshop in the 70s, starting White Dwarf, working with Bryan Ansell as his Citadel team created Warhammer, co-writing Fighting Fantasy with Sir Ian Livingstone, and creating cutting edge interactive storytelling over the phone with Steve Jackson's F.I.S.T (Fantasy Interactive Scenarios by Telephone!)

Tomas Rawlings | Video Game Developer & Behaviourist
Tomas Rawlings in conversation with Jordan Sorcery.
We talk about the culture, behaviours, and perceptions of the video game and tabletop gaming hobbies and industries. As an exceptional thinker on the nature of gaming Tomas has given TED talks, consulted across the video games industry, written tabletop games, and co-founded his own games studio, Auroch Digital, to push the boundaries of what games can mean.
In more recent times Tomas and Auroch have adapted classic Games Workshop titles like Chainsaw Warrior and Dark Future for the video game market. And in their latest release they have taken the Warhammer 40,000 universe and refracted it through the lens of retro first person shooters with Boltgun.
We cover enlightening topics about the past, the future, and the value of gaming in society.
